Saving money on groceries is a smart habit that can significantly reduce your monthly expenses. With a few practical strategies, you can cut costs without compromising on quality.

1. Plan Before You Shop

Create a weekly or monthly meal plan. This helps avoid impulse buying and ensures you purchase only what you need.

2. Make a Grocery List

Stick to a strict list. This prevents unnecessary purchases and keeps your spending under control.

3. Buy in Bulk

Items like rice, flour, pulses, and oil are cheaper when bought in bulk. This also reduces frequent trips to the store.

4. Choose Local Kirana Stores

Local shops often provide better prices, discounts, and even credit options. Plus, you save on delivery charges.

5. Avoid Packaged Foods

Packaged and branded products are usually more expensive. Opt for loose items like grains and spices when possible.

6. Compare Prices

Before buying, compare prices across stores or brands. Even small differences add up over time.

7. Use Seasonal Products

Seasonal fruits and vegetables are cheaper and fresher.

8. Avoid Shopping When Hungry

You are more likely to buy unnecessary snacks when hungry.

9. Use Discounts Wisely

Take advantage of offers but only if you actually need the product.

10. Track Your Spending

Keep a record of your grocery expenses to identify where you can cut costs.

By following these simple tips, you can manage your grocery budget effectively and save a significant amount every month.
